MSLEA is seeking presidential candidates! This term will be for the balance of the present term (approximately 13
months). Anyone interested in running for President needs to contact the MSLEA webmaster and add their name to the list
of candidates. Candidates should then post their “platform” on the website so the members can read about them prior to
voting. Individual member groups will be voting through their Board Directors and will only have until 9/5/08 to cast their
ballot. The new President will be “seated” along with new Board Directors at the annual meeting on 9/27/08. Members will
be contacted on or about 8/21/08 with the list of Presidential candidates, along with candidates for Board Directors. If
members have questions they should contact their Board Directors.
